My Buying Guides on Ssd Sata 2.5 1tb
Why I Chose a 2.5″ SATA 1TB SSD
When I started looking for a storage upgrade, I wanted something simple, reliable, and compatible with most laptops and desktops. A 2.5″ SATA 1TB SSD stood out to me because it offers a great balance of speed, capacity, and value. I found it especially useful for replacing an older hard drive and giving my system a noticeable performance boost without needing a more expensive NVMe setup.
What I Looked for First
My first priority was compatibility. I made sure my device supported a 2.5-inch SATA drive before buying. I also checked the storage bay size, cable type, and whether I needed a mounting bracket or adapter. Since not every system supports the same drive thickness, I paid attention to the 7mm or 9.5mm form factor as well.
Performance I Considered
I compared read and write speeds because they directly affect how fast my computer boots, loads apps, and transfers files. For a SATA SSD, I knew I wouldn’t get NVMe-level speeds, but I still expected a huge improvement over a traditional HDD. I also looked at random performance, since that matters a lot for everyday use like opening programs and multitasking.
Reliability and Endurance
I always check the endurance rating before making a purchase. I looked at TBW, warranty length, and brand reputation because I wanted a drive that would last. A 1TB SSD is a long-term investment for me, so I prefer models with at least a 3-year warranty and solid reviews from real users.
Brand and Controller Quality
I learned that not all SSDs are built the same, even if they have similar specs on paper. I paid attention to the controller and NAND type because these affect consistency and durability. I tend to trust established brands more, especially when they have a good track record for firmware support and product reliability.
Price vs Value
When I shop for storage, I don’t just go for the cheapest option. I compare price per gigabyte, warranty, and performance together. Sometimes I found that spending a little more gave me better reliability and faster speeds, which felt worth it for my daily use.
Use Case Matters
I thought about how I would use the SSD before buying. For general computing, office work, media storage, and gaming, a 1TB SATA SSD is more than enough for me. If I were doing heavy video editing or large file workflows, I might consider a faster NVMe drive instead. But for most users, I feel this size and type is a very practical choice.
Installation Ease
I also considered how easy it would be to install. A 2.5″ SATA SSD is one of the simplest upgrades I’ve done. In most cases, I only needed a screwdriver and a SATA data and power connection. I always recommend checking whether cloning software is included or whether I need to back up my data before installation.
My Final Buying Tip
If I were buying a 2.5″ SATA 1TB SSD today, I would focus on compatibility, warranty, endurance, and trusted brand quality first. I would choose a model that offers consistent performance rather than chasing the highest advertised speed. For me, the best SSD is the one that gives dependable everyday performance and lasts a long time.
